The court granted a temporary stay of all eight proceedings pending determination of the Probate Appeal because the balance of convenience and effective case management favored a short stay: if Mrs Wang succeeds on probate the proceedings will be pointless and continuation would cause substantial wasted costs, disruption to the Chinachem group's treasury system and judicial resources; the stay is temporary, applicants filed evidence showing magnitude of cost and disruption, administrators offered a formal rather than substantive resistance, and no cogent basis existed to impose the proposed e…
